4. Mobile Commerce Overview
Mobile commerce (m-commerce,
m-business) , any e-commerce done in a wireless
environment, especially via the Internet
Can be done via the Internet, private
communication lines, smart cards, etc.
Creates opportunity to deliver new services to
existing customers and to attract new ones

9. The advantages of
M-Commerce
Mobility—users carry cell phones or other mobile
devices
Broad reach—people can be reached at any time
Ubiquity—easier information access in real-time
Convenience—devices that store data and have
Internet, intranet, extranet connections
9
10. Advantage
Instant connectivity—easy and quick connection
to Internet, intranets, other mobile devices,
databases
Personalization—preparation of information for
individual consumers
Localization of products and services—knowing
where the user is located at any given time and
match service to them

18. framework 18
Application : many new application are becoming
possible , and many existing e-commerce application
can be modified for a mobile environment.
User infrastructure : the design of new mobile
commerce application should consider the
capabilities of the user infrastructure the mobile
device.
19. framework 19
Wireless middleware : with its ability to hide the
underlying networks details from application while
providing a uniform and easy to use interface ,
middleware is extremely important for developing
new mobile commerce application
Networks infrastructure : in mobile commerce ,
service quality primarily depends on network
resources and capabilities
20. framework 20
The framework also provides a developer
provider plane , which addresses the different
needs and views of application developers ,
content providers , and service provider
